Guidance from Leading Zumba Instruction Sources

Engaging with prominent Zumba instruction sources offers unique pathways to fitness and well-being. Understanding the nuances of their instruction can maximize the benefits of participation.

Tip 1: Assess Instructor Credentials: Verify the instructor’s certifications and experience. Look for evidence of formal Zumba training and consider instructors with additional fitness qualifications.

Tip 2: Prioritize Form Over Intensity: Focus on maintaining proper body alignment and technique during each movement. Sacrificing form to keep up with the pace can increase the risk of injury.

Tip 3: Adapt Routines to Fitness Level: Modify exercises to match personal capabilities. Lower impact variations or reduced range of motion can accommodate individuals with physical limitations.

Tip 4: Utilize Warm-up and Cool-down Segments: Always participate in the warm-up and cool-down portions of each class. These segments prepare the body for exercise and facilitate recovery, respectively.

Tip 5: Incorporate Variety: Explore different instructors and Zumba styles to prevent plateaus and maintain engagement. Exposure to various teaching approaches enhances overall fitness and skill development.

Tip 6: Hydrate Adequately: Consume sufficient water before, during, and after Zumba sessions to maintain optimal hydration levels and support performance.

Tip 7: Listen to the Body: Pay attention to physical signals and avoid pushing through pain. Rest and recovery are essential components of a successful fitness regimen.

Adhering to these guidelines will enhance the efficacy and safety of online Zumba participation, promoting a positive and sustainable fitness experience.

1. Credibility

1. Credibility, Youtube

In the context of online dance-fitness resources, credibility emerges as a paramount factor influencing user trust and the potential efficacy of the instruction. Without verifiable expertise, the safety and effectiveness of the presented routines become questionable, potentially leading to injury or ineffective workouts.

  • Instructor Certification Verification

    The presence of recognized Zumba certifications indicates a baseline level of professional training. These certifications, typically awarded by Zumba Fitness, LLC, demonstrate that the instructor has completed the necessary coursework and possesses a foundational understanding of Zumba techniques and safety protocols. Confirmation of these credentials adds weight to the instructor’s claims of expertise.

  • Experience and Background

    Beyond initial certification, an instructor’s accumulated experience plays a significant role in establishing credibility. Demonstrated history of teaching Zumba, documented performance experience, and testimonials from previous students provide valuable insights into their practical skills and pedagogical effectiveness. Extended experience often translates to a more nuanced understanding of movement variations and personalized instruction.

  • Endorsements and Affiliations

    Collaborations with reputable fitness organizations or endorsements from established health professionals can enhance an instructor’s credibility. Affiliations with recognized brands within the fitness industry signify a level of professional validation and adherence to industry standards. Such associations often reflect a commitment to providing high-quality, evidence-based instruction.

  • Transparency and Professionalism

    Openly providing information about qualifications, experience, and training methodologies contributes to a perception of trustworthiness. Transparent communication, ethical conduct, and professional demeanor are indicative of a serious commitment to providing responsible and effective fitness guidance. The absence of such transparency can raise concerns about the legitimacy of the instruction.

Credibility, therefore, functions as a cornerstone for discerning quality dance-fitness instruction. Identifying channels that prioritize demonstrable expertise provides users with a higher likelihood of achieving their fitness objectives safely and effectively.

4. Fitness Level

4. Fitness Level, Youtube

Assessing and accommodating various fitness levels is paramount when curating and utilizing online dance-fitness resources. Disregard for individual fitness capabilities can lead to ineffective workouts or increased risk of injury, diminishing the potential benefits of accessing Zumba instruction online. The effectiveness of these digital resources hinges on their ability to cater to a broad spectrum of physical conditioning.

  • Beginner-Friendly Content

    Channels that cater to beginners often feature modified routines with lower impact movements and simplified choreography. The pace of instruction is typically slower, allowing ample time for participants to learn and execute the steps correctly. Real-world examples include channels offering introductory series with detailed explanations of basic Zumba steps and gradual increases in intensity. These features are crucial for individuals new to dance-fitness to establish a foundation without risking overexertion or injury.

  • Intermediate and Advanced Routines

    For individuals with established fitness levels, channels provide routines incorporating complex choreography, increased intensity, and advanced techniques. These sessions challenge experienced participants and facilitate continued progress. For example, channels may offer interval training routines, incorporating high-intensity bursts with active recovery periods. They may also feature routines that incorporate elements of other dance styles, increasing the complexity and physical demands.

  • Modifications and Variations

    The most effective channels provide modifications and variations for exercises, accommodating individuals with different physical limitations or fitness goals. These modifications allow participants to adjust the intensity and impact of the movements to suit their individual needs. Examples include offering low-impact alternatives to jumping jacks or providing options to modify the range of motion during squats. Accessible modifications are crucial for ensuring inclusivity and minimizing the risk of injury.

  • Progressive Training Programs

    Channels that structure their content into progressive training programs allow participants to gradually increase their fitness levels over time. These programs typically start with beginner-level routines and gradually progress to more challenging workouts. The structured approach helps participants build strength, endurance, and coordination progressively, optimizing their fitness gains while minimizing the risk of overtraining or injury. Regular assessment and feedback mechanisms can enhance the efficacy of these programs.

Frequently Asked Questions

The following section addresses common inquiries regarding the selection and utilization of digital dance-fitness platforms, focusing on maximizing benefits and minimizing potential risks.

Question 1: What factors should be prioritized when assessing the credibility of dance-fitness instructors online?

Instructor certifications, documented experience, professional affiliations, and transparency regarding training methodologies should be considered. Verifiable credentials and a demonstrated history of effective instruction are indicative of expertise.

Question 2: How can individuals ensure proper form and technique when participating in digital dance-fitness routines?

Focus on clear demonstrations, utilize slow-motion options (if available), and prioritize controlled movements. It may be necessary to record oneself to compare form to the instructor’s example.

Question 3: What are the potential risks associated with participating in unsupervised digital dance-fitness classes?

Improper form can lead to injury. Individuals should consult a medical professional before starting any new fitness routine and should listen to their bodies, stopping if pain occurs. Ensure adequate space and a safe environment.

Question 4: How can musical variety contribute to the efficacy of dance-fitness programs?

Exposure to diverse musical styles can enhance engagement, prevent boredom, and cater to varied preferences. Strategic incorporation of culturally relevant music can promote inclusivity and connection.

Question 5: How can one adapt digital dance-fitness routines to accommodate varying fitness levels?

Modifications and variations should be employed to adjust intensity and impact. Beginners should prioritize low-impact options and gradually increase the challenge as fitness improves. Rest when needed.

Question 6: What role does user engagement play in determining the value of digital dance-fitness platforms?

High engagement levels, as evidenced by likes, comments, and shares, suggest that content resonates with the audience and fosters a sense of community. Active interaction is indicative of a valuable resource.
